Welcome Aboard - pendleton. marines. mil Welcome to Marine Corps Base Camp Pendleton Located 42 miles north of San Diego International Airport (Lindbergh Field) and 88 miles south of Los Angeles International Airport (LAX), Camp Pendleton is home to Marine Corps Installations West-Marine Corps Base Camp Pendleton, Marine Corps Air Station Camp Pendleton, I Marine Expeditionary Force, 1st Marine Division, 1st Marine Logistics Group
